Fifth person charged with Bulwell teenager's murder

A 16-year old boy has been charged with murder in connection with the death of Bulwell 17-year old Lyrico Steede.

The 16-year old, who cannot be named for legal reasons, is due to appear at Nottingham Magistrates Court on Saturday, March 31.

He is the fifth person to be charged with murder in connection with the teenager’s death, after Kasharn Campbell, 19, of no fixed address, and three teenagers were also charged with murder.

Campbell and the three teenagers – two 17-year old boys and a 15-year old girl, who cannot be named for legal reasons – are all due to stand trial at Nottingham Crown Court on Tuesday, October 2.

A sixth person – a 17-year old girl, who also cannot be named for legal reasons – has also previously been charged with assisting an offender in connection with the incident. She is due to appear at Nottingham Youth Court on Tuesday, April 3.

Lyrico, known to his friends as Rico, was stabbed a number of times in an attack which started at Hempshill Lane Recreation Ground before he was chased and left with serious injuries in Stock Well, Bulwell, in February. He died in hospital six days later.
